#4da4b5 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#4da4b5 is composed of 30.2% red, 64.3% green and 71%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 57.5% cyan, 9.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 29% black. It has a hue angle of 189.8 degrees, a saturation of 41.3% and a lightness of 50.6%. #4da4b5 color hex could be obtained by blending #9affff with #00496b. Closest websafe color is: #6699cc.

#4da4b5 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#4da4b5 has RGB values of R:77, G:164, B:181 and CMYK values of C:0.57, M:0.09, Y:0, K:0.29. Its decimal value is 5088437.

Shades and Tints of #4da4b5
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010202 is the darkest color, while #f3f9fa is the lightest one.
